Blue Ridge, VA vs University of Virginia, VA
There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Blue Ridge is 17.3% cheaper than University of Virginia. With a cost index of 92 vs 111,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Blue Ridge to University of Virginia should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.
When it comes to buying, median home values in Blue Ridge are $247,900 compared to $422,200 in University of Virginia, a 41% gap.
Median household income in Blue Ridge is $83,113 compared to $44,635 in University of Virginia (+86.2%). Blue Ridge off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power.
